Rajnath calls Naeem Akhtar, enquires his well being after Tral blast

Srinagar: Indian Minister for Home, Rajnath Singh on Thursday called Minister for Works, Naeem Akhtar to enquire about his well being in the aftermath of a grenade attack on his cavalcade in Tral.
Governor, N N Vohra, Chief Minister, Mehbooba Mufti, Deputy Chief Minister, Dr Nirmal Singh, other members of the council of Ministers, Legislators and people from different walks of life also called the Minister expressing solidarity with him.
